Key Responsibilities & Deliverables:
This role is focused on the successful execution of systems-related analytical activities. Your responsibilities will include:
- Requirements Analysis: Leading requirements meetings with analysts and end-users to break down product requirements into detailed work categories and user interactions.
- Documentation: Creating comprehensive requirements documents, including use cases, flow diagrams, detailed business rules, and system design specifications (user stories, screen shots, and UI documents).
- Technical Liaison: Serving as the bridge between business clients, IT Infrastructure, and development groups to ensure technical feasibility and project alignment.
- Translation: Analyzing business needs and translating them into technical configurations that guide developer programming and configuration work.
- Agile Participation: Actively participating in Agile ceremonies, including Scrum stand-up calls and sprint planning.
- Relationship Building: Developing strong relationships with business partners and vendors to ensure successful system implementations and application upgrades.
